Dr. Laizure Studies Caffeine

|

Professors at University of Tennessee Health Science Center (UTHSC) plan to be the first in the country to study how rapidly caffeine gets into the body after an energy drink is consumed or a caffeine powder is inhaled using an Aeroshot device. Dr. S. Casey Laizure, Professor in the Department of Clinical Pharmacy at the UTHSC College of Pharmacy, recently received a $150,000 grant from the National Institute on Drug Abuse (part of the National Institutes of Health) to support the study.
